AI Verdict

HOV BEARISH

HOV presents a precarious profile characterized by a stable but mediocre Piotroski F-Score of 4/9 and a complete lack of positive technical momentum. While the stock trades below its Graham Number ($131.04), suggesting defensive value, it is severely overvalued relative to its growth-based intrinsic value ($45.29) and the sole analyst target price of $74.00. The company is experiencing significant contraction, with YoY earnings growth plummeting by 26.8% and a forward P/E that is higher than the current P/E, signaling expected earnings declines. Thin profit margins and erratic historical earnings surprises further undermine the investment thesis.

KRUS BEARISH

KRUS exhibits severe fundamental weakness, highlighted by a Piotroski F-Score of 2/9, indicating poor financial health and deteriorating operational efficiency. While revenue growth remains strong at 23.3%, the company struggles with negative profit and operating margins, making the Forward P/E of 194.65 fundamentally unsustainable. The disconnect between bullish analyst targets and bearish insider activity, combined with a 0/100 technical trend, suggests a high-risk profile. The stock is currently priced for aggressive growth that is not yet supported by bottom-line profitability.
